Harriett Woods insists that it will take more than a woman president to assure that women have effective political power in the next millennium. Stepping Up to Power looks backward in order to move women forward; Woods believes that getting more women to enter the political arena will take both their commitment and a knowledge of the past. The author uses her own life story to recall how women excluded from public life were fired by their determination to solve local problems and by their passion for social issues.
